@falconCoin GPU can speed it up, but there is a capacity threshold you need to pass for GPU to be faster than CPU. For my dual mining machines, nicehash runs at low priority, and the miner at high priority - that way the additional mining has minimal impact on Burst mining.

#1 if you have never done it , do a lot of research first. most people think just throw some high end GFX card in and off you go... wile its a peace of cake to add HDD's for burst mining to an existing GPU rig going the other way depending on your setup can requier a complet rig rebuild... assuming you have cheep electric in your area.. #1 is cooling is a MUST most GPU rigs need x2 more cooling than an average computer even if it seems to be ok . running a rig at 100% even a little over normal temp's will cause things to fail much faster.. #2 90% of average computers do not have a PSU that can handle the load of 4,5,6, or even 7 high end GPU cards plan on replacing that as well. invest in a Jig or get some lumber if your handy multi cards will not fit inside a regular case and need to be hooked up via powered riser cables on the + that makes cooling a little more easy. last .. as with ASIC's you need high end GPU's to be profitable ... even top modles from 2 years ago will eat your profits up in electric.. there are lots of nice charts online you can google to see hashing power of various cards best bet would be to check the top 5 or 6 models compare price and compare how much electric it uses to find the current sweet spot.

@falconCoin GPU can plot as fast or faster than high end CPU rigs, but I've got GPU plotted files that may be corrupt. As a result I now only use xplotter, but it's a very high end rig, to be able to match a generic GPU.
